Tessolve to acquire Dream Chip Technologies

November 6, 2024 — Tessolve, a Hero Electronix venture and a leader in semiconductor engineering, has signed a definitive agreement to acquire Dream Chip Technologies, a semiconductor chip design firm headquartered in Germany, for around ₹400 Crore (EUR 42.5 million).

GlobalFoundries Fined $500,000 for Unauthorized Chip Shipments

November  5, 2024 — GlobalFoundries, the world’s third-largest semiconductor foundry, has been fined $500,000 by the U.S. Bureau of Industry and Security (BIS) for unauthorized shipments of chips to SJ Semiconductor, an affiliate of the blacklisted Chinese chipmaker SMIC. TSMC Faces Record Energy Prices

[November 5, 2024] – Taiwan’s ambitious energy transition is creating significant challenges for its industries, particularly the semiconductor sector. Recent sharp increases in electricity prices and growing risks of power outages are impacting major companies, including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company (TSMC), the world’s largest chipmaker.
